PROJECT: Addition to McCormick Hall, Bloomsburg University
LOCATION: Bloomsburg, PA
COMPLETION DATE: August, 2007
SERVICES: Building Systems Engineering

SYNOPSIS:

Addition to the McCormick Hall includes two (2) new state of the art 250 seat lecture halls and two (2) 75 seat classrooms/ computer labs. Arris is providing the design for room acoustics, sound systems, specialty lighting & dimming, video projection/control and information technologies, such as LAN, WAN, a wireless networks.

ACOUSTICAL ANALYSIS: Utilizing 3D modeling we will design ceilings and propose wall treatments to provide intelligible well defined spaces. Provide seating requirements for absorptive characteristics to provide a room that has constant acoustics form empty to full seating conditions. Provide Noise Criteria goals. Provide review of acoustical elements. Where acoustical design impacts walls and ceilings the coordination of these elements will be by the architect. Acoustical work will consist of material and performance specifications which will require inclusion in the general construction specifications.

AUDIO SYSTEM:  Design sound system for program playback as well as speech reinforcement. The ability to record classes will be included but will require some interaction from the instructor. The general sound system operation will be automated and require little or no interaction. Hearing assistance is anticipated and will be coordinated for compatibility with other hearing assistance methods/systems on campus and the needs of the users.

PROJECT: Cabling Infrastructure Upgrade Project
LOCATION: Scranton, PA
COMPLETION DATE: January, 2006
SERVICES: Building Systems Engineering

SYNOPSIS:

Arris Engineering Group has been selected by the PA Department of General Services to perform a major cabling infrastructure upgrade to the Scranton School for the Deaf located in Dunmore, Pa.  The campus style facility includes many historic stone and mortar structures and is completely interconnected through extensive tunnel systems. The availability of new teaching methodologies and technologies has increased the need to distribute information over greater bandwidth media and to have it distributed to students at an increasing number of locations throughout the campus.

Arris will perform an analysis of the subject technologies and design a new media transmission backbone that will provide for the needs of the school through the foreseeable future.  The new cabling system will route to centrally located distribution hubs to be located on each floor of each campus building.  Distribution to the end use points will be included in this project only for a select number of locations.  Additional budget funding is expected to allow the systems to be carried into every office, classroom, recreational space and student dorm room in the future.

Arris will also be responsible for all construction administration services associated with the project implementation and construction.

PROJECT: Borgata Casino
LOCATION: Atlantic Ciy, NJ
COMPLETION DATE: October 2005
SERVICES: Building Systems Engineering - Mission Critical

OVERVIEW: Dual 100KVA UPS Systems For the Network Operations Center

SYNOPSIS:

The project included the design of parallel 100KVA Uninterruptible Power Supplies for the Network Operations Center at the Borgata Casino in Atlantic City, NJ.

The UPS System was designed by Arris Engineering Group through the system component distributor Integrated Power Systems, Inc.

Due to technology upgrades, the existing UPS System at the Casino was operating in a constant overload condition. Based upon load study information gathered within the Casino, dual 100KVA UPS units were determined to meet the future requirements of the facility.

Arris completed the field investigation of the existing systems and developed a phasing plan that allowed all network system components to be transferred to the new system without more than a 5 second outage.

The UPS units were fed from separate sources and delivered power through a static transfer switch to two double 200 Amp power distribution cabinets located within the central command center of the Casino.

A complete new grounding scheme was also designed for the Technology Center.
